Priory Bay Hotel - Seaview
50.7093737725455, -1.10619731247425The comfortable Priory Bay Hotel Seaview offers 16 rooms about a 10-minute drive from Bembridge Windmill. This hotel offers Wi-Fi in public areas.
Location
The Seaview hotel enjoys proximity to St Helens Fort, located 1.2 miles away. Westridge Golf Club is within easy walking distance of the accommodation, while The Bench bus stop is about a 5-minute walk away. Seaview Wildlife Encounter is 1.6 miles from this 3-star hotel.
Rooms
The rooms at Priory Bay Hotel provide guests with a multi-channel television, as well as comforts such as ironing facilities and an iron/ironing board. In-room bathrooms feature a tub, a separate toilet, and a shower along with dressing gowns and a hair dryer.
Eat & Drink
The hotel offers a full breakfast at the price of GBP 12.50 per person per day. You can start your day with a continental breakfast, which costs GBP 7 per person per day.
